#92: Government Data - Unlocking value through Adaptive Data Governance
An episode of the Government Transformation Show podcast, hosted by Government Transformation Magazine, titled "#92: Government Data - Unlocking value through Adaptive Data Governance" was published on May 17, 2023 and runs 31 minutes.

Summary
Government Data exists in a complex, ever-changing environment with many stakeholders - and against this backdrop Adaptive Data Governance is a way of managing data that emphasises flexibility and responsiveness to change. Just as an organisation's data landscape, business needs, regulatory environment, and technological capabilities change, so a department's data governance will need to evolve. Sam talks to Alberto Villari and Steve Holyer, two data experts from Informatica, to examine how to maximise the value of adaptive data governance in the public sector.
